Introduction

Inventor uses two types of dimensions: model and drawing. Model dimensions are created as the model is being constructed and may be edited to change the shape of a model. Drawing dimensions can be edited, but the changes will not change the shape of the model. If the shape of a model is changed, the drawing dimensions associated with the revised surfaces will change to reflect the new values.

model dimension

A dimension created as a model is being constructed; it may be edited to change the shape of a model.
